> Wikipedia says (about Triggerfish):
>
> "Intercepting a cell phone call by a man in the middle attack, if the option 
> is enabled, and the user makes or receives a call."
>
 
 Tracking of a cell phone by a mobile FBI van (Wireless Intercept and Tracking
 Team) which seeks to locate a cell phone lacking GPS tracking by scanning for
 its emissions. This first became known for its use in tracking hacker Kevin
 Mitnick.[1] 

 Intercepting a cell phone call by a man in the middle attack ...

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Triggerfish_(surveillance)

Other than the FBI stalking a criminal element in an unmarked van parked
across the street stuffed with sophisticated electronic equipment, I don't
believe this theoretical possibility translates to a worrisome probability of
malicious behavior for the R.H. Kramers of the world.
